Danish Diet For 13 Days With A Menu Per Day!


The Danish diet lasting 13 days is intended for detoxification of the body, but also for weight loss. Guarantees a loss of up to 10 pounds in less than two weeks, but only if you stick to the menu because if you make a mistake you have to go back to the first day of the diet!

After this child, the effect will not already happen, and if you stop it, you should not start it again for at least 3 months.

Only 600 kcal

Danish diets are called Danish hospital diets. It is based on particularly strict rules and limitations that not only lose unwanted kilograms but also improve metabolism and reduce cellulite. The key to success of a Danish child is a significant reduction in fat and carbohydrate consumption and a low daily calorie intake of about 600 kcal. This diet prohibits certain types of fruits, potatoes, sugar, pasta and cereal products and recommends moderate consumption of eggs, meat, salads, fish and coffee.

The main disadvantage of this baby is that the body does not get all the nutrients it needs and so it is recommended that it lasts only 13 days to avoid damaging the body. This diet is not recommended for those who do mental and physical affairs to the sick or those who have recently been ill because they weaken the immune system. The advantage of this baby is to speed up metabolism, ensure fat loss and ensure that the kilograms will not return for another two years. Before carrying out this or similar restrictive child, be sure to consult a physician and nutritionist.

Nutritionist Mirje Jošić comments: “The Danish dieting is caloric intake in a low energy intake (VLCD) diet, which is why it must be carried out with professional help. Diet certainly allows for weight loss, however because of the extreme restriction the risk of the already-already effect is great. Also, the hypothesis that diet will accelerate metabolism should be taken with skepticism because such restrictive programs in fact result in slowing down metabolism. Incredible breakfast makes it more difficult for you to keep up on the diet because you will be getting hungry and trying to control the intake of food fast. Due to the restriction there is a deficiency of vitamins and minerals, so it is necessary to take the multivitamin-mineral preparation along with the diet. ”
